Lawn edging involves creating a clear boundary between your lawn and adjacent surfaces such as walkways, flower beds, or driveways. This practice is vital because it improves the aesthetic appeal of your garden and makes maintenance easier by keeping grass from creeping into non-lawn areas. The first step towards achieving excellent lawn edging is selecting the appropriate tools. For most homeowners, a good-quality manual edging tool or a powered edge trimmer will suffice. Manual edging tools are perfect for smaller areas or for gardeners who enjoy hands-on work. On the other hand, powered edge trimmers, such as those using electric or gas power, are ideal for larger properties and require less manual effort. Whichever tool you choose, ensure it is well-maintained to deliver clean cuts.

Once you have your tools ready, it’s essential to plan your edging path. Take into account existing lawn features such as garden beds and patios. A well-planned edging line should flow naturally with these elements to create a harmonious look. For straight edges, use a string line or garden hose as a guide to ensure precision. When creating curves, gently follow the natural bend of the lawn to maintain a smooth, even appearance.

Begin the edging process by inserting your chosen tool into the turf at a 90-degree angle. For manual tools, gently slice through the grass using a sawing motion. If you're using a powered edger, guide the device steadily along the edge line. The aim is to create a trench or groove that distinctly separates the grass from other areas. Remember to remove cut grass and debris from the trench to maintain a clearly defined edge.

Regular maintenance of lawn edges is crucial. Depending on the growth rate of your grass, you may need to re-edge every few weeks. This prevents grass from growing into unwanted areas, keeping your garden neat and tidy. Additionally, periodically sharpen your edging tools to maintain cleanliness and efficiency in your work.
